Chapter 40

Although the panda cub seemed simple, it was still an S-level spirit beast with strong sensing abilities. If it wanted, it could know many things.

Seeing Bai Nuosi’s amazed look, the panda cub became proud and started to show off. But Chu Jiangting noticed the panda’s intention and immediately took control of its consciousness through their bond.

Bai Nuosi watched as the previously excited panda cub suddenly closed its mouth, gave a shy smile, and placed its paws over its belly, looking embarrassed.

Bai Nuosi: “…”

This child’s mood sure changes fast.

Bai Nuosi turned to check on the sleeping snake baby, who was peacefully resting. He gently stroked the little snake’s head, then opened the book and began telling the panda cub its story. “This story is about Naby the little rabbit and is called Naby’s Moonlight Knight.”

Chu Jiangting, staying within the panda cub’s consciousness, leaned against Bai Nuosi, not daring to move!

The panda cub had cuddled close to Bai Nuosi, its head resting on his chest, half its body snuggled warmly into Bai’s embrace.

The panda cub loved being this close, and Bai Nuosi enjoyed the soft, fluffy panda being near him too.

But!

Chu Jiangting was having a hard time.

He had never been so close to anyone before, let alone to an Omega who was about the same age, beautiful, and gentle.

Awkwardly, he placed the panda cub’s paws on its belly, huddled in Teacher Bai’s warm embrace, not daring to lift his head to meet Bai’s eyes. His small eyes were fixed intently on the book.

Bai Nuosi opened the first page and pointed to the illustration, saying, “Little Rabbit Naby is going to school, but the school is very far away. Every morning, she has to cross a hillside full of blooming flowers, a deep, endless river, and pass through a dark valley. Little Rabbit Naby is scared; she has never gone so far on her own before.”

Bai Nuosi’s voice was soft and gentle. Chu Jiangting thought Teacher Bai’s voice sounded so pleasant that he lifted his head slightly, sneaking a glance at the kind teacher.

Bai Nuosi, with his head lowered, had soft black hair falling over his forehead, and the warm yellow light cast a golden glow around his deep, dark eyes. He was smiling slightly, calm and serene.

Just as the panda cub peeked up while Bai was turning a page, Bai Nuosi suddenly looked over, catching it in the act.

Chu Jiangting: “…”

Reflexively, Chu Jiangting averted his gaze. He didn’t even know why he felt so nervous, but his heart began racing, and his cheeks felt hot.

The panda cub, embarrassed from being caught, looked too cute, and Bai Nuosi couldn’t resist reaching out to ruffle its head.

Pointing to the picture in the book, Bai Nuosi continued, “So, Naby’s grandmother took out a glowing, moon-shaped necklace and placed it around Naby’s neck. Grandma said, ‘Don’t be afraid, Naby. When you face danger, the Moonlight Knight will protect you!’”

“And so, Little Rabbit Naby put on her backpack, her boots, and brought along her Moonlight Knight for protection.”

“We’re ready to go, my Moonlight Knight,” Naby whispered, touching the glowing moon at her chest.

For the first time, Little Naby walked down this path. As she crossed the flower-filled hillside, she whispered, “I think this place is beautiful, and the bad guys will probably think so too. I’d better take a detour. What do you think, Moonlight Knight?”

The Moonlight Knight didn’t speak, but its gentle light seemed to silently support Naby’s decision.

At that moment, Naby didn’t notice the big bad wolf hiding in the flower bushes, watching her leave with disappointment.

Bai Nuosi turned the page, and the panda cub was completely absorbed in the story.

Chu Jiangting thought to himself, This little rabbit is pretty smart!

Bai continued, “Naby kept walking and walking until she reached the deep river. She hesitated and said to the Moonlight Knight, ‘There’s only one bridge here. If the bad guys block us on the bridge, we’ll be in trouble.’”

So, Little Rabbit Naby, with her Moonlight Knight, hopped from stone to stone upstream and crossed the river that way.

Bai Nuosi went on, “Finally, Little Rabbit Naby reached the dark valley. Staring at the pitch-black path ahead, she was terrified. But then, she saw that her Moonlight Knight was glowing brightly! The knight must have been encouraging her!”

Naby exclaimed, “Moonlight Knight, you’re amazing! Without you, I wouldn’t have the courage to cross this dark valley!”

Bai Nuosi continued, “Just like that, Little Rabbit Naby successfully completed the long journey and arrived at her school deep in the forest just as the sun was rising.”

“Naby grew very fond of her Moonlight Knight. Whenever she made a new friend, she proudly introduced her knight to them.”

“With the Moonlight Knight by her side, Naby grew up day by day. But one day, suddenly, her Moonlight Knight disappeared!”

Bai sighed and pointed to the illustration, showing the heartbroken Naby crying in her grandmother’s arms. “Naby sobbed, ‘Grandma, Grandma! My Moonlight Knight is gone! What will I do without it?’”

“Naby was devastated. She felt she could never cross that flower-filled hillside, the deep river, or the dark valley without her knight.”

Bai Nuosi turned to the next page. “Grandma hugged Naby and smiled. ‘How could that be? You’ve been walking just fine all this time!’”

“It wasn’t the Moonlight Knight who walked those roads for you; it was you, Naby.”

“The Moonlight Knight only stayed by your side, and when faced with the unknown, it didn’t give you any advice or help you through the tough spots. The one who decided which path to take was you, Naby.”

Bai Nuosi turned to the last page, showing a grown-up Naby, wearing her boots and backpack, with a determined look in her eyes. “Little Rabbit Naby had grown up and learned to walk her own path. The journey ahead was long and full of challenges, but sometimes Naby still thought of the Moonlight Knight who once accompanied her.”

“But from then on, whether or not someone was by her side, Naby decided she would rely on herself and walk her own path. She would become her own knight.”

Bai Nuosi closed the book and looked at the quiet panda cub. He whispered, “I hope Qiuqiu can be brave too, and not depend on anyone or anything. Those things can accompany you for a while, but they can’t stay with you forever. To grow, you must decide how to walk your own path. Only by becoming your own knight can you keep moving forward on this challenging journey.”

The panda cub nodded somberly, though Bai wasn’t sure if the cub fully understood these lessons.

But even if it didn’t understand now, that was okay. Picture books were meant to bring joy, teach about colors, and expand the imagination. It wasn’t realistic to expect little ones to grasp such big life lessons right away.

Bai Nuosi put away the picture book, reached out to rub the little panda cub’s head, then kissed its forehead and softly said, “Alright, the story of Little Bunny Naby is over. Qiuqiu, it’s time for bed now.”

The panda cub nodded obediently and watched as Teacher Bai gently covered it with a small blanket.

It stretched out its little paw, pulling the blanket up over its belly, then quietly said to Teacher Bai, “Goodnight, teacher.”

Bai Nuosi softly replied, “Goodnight, Qiuqiu.”

He dimmed the lights, turned on some soft music, and expertly tucked a plush bunny into the panda cub’s arms.

Hugging the little bunny, the panda cub murmured to the toy before closing its eyes, “Goodnight, Naby.”

The panda cub soon fell asleep. After making sure the cub wouldn’t wake up, Chu Jiangting, who had been silently observing, finally left after hearing the teacher’s ‘nonsense.’

He exited the training ground and returned to the dormitory, where he noticed a message on a second-hand website from someone interested in purchasing his mental power enhancer.

Chu Jiangting looked at the buyer’s transaction record, silently returned to his room, and retrieved a box of brand-new mental power enhancers from his storage locker.

Farewell, my knight.

Watching the mental power enhancers being sent off to the Star Shuttle delivery station, he suddenly felt a weight lift from his heart, as if something that had been burdening him had left along with the enhancers.

At that moment, he remembered the words of the grandmother in Little Bunny Naby’s story: “The one who walked those mountain roads was not the Moon Knight, but you.”

Chu Jiangting couldn’t help but feel that Teacher Bai had told the story on purpose, just for him. But Bai Nuosi didn’t know anything about his spirit animal or his past, so maybe it was just a coincidence.

Coincidence or not, the story brought him great comfort and guidance.

All these years, it was him who had walked this difficult road and reached his destination. The mental power enhancers didn’t play as big a role as he had thought.

For as long as he could remember, his mother had instilled in him the importance of the mental power enhancers.

She told him he had to take them on time every day, or his mental power would stagnate, and he would fail to undergo his transformation. Even after he successfully became an S-class, she insisted that without the enhancers, his mental power would deteriorate, and he wouldn’t be able to maintain his S-class status.

Although Chu Jiangting had always felt his mother’s emotions were unstable and her words unreliable, deep down, he believed her. So, despite knowing he was allergic and that his sense of taste was deteriorating, he never stopped taking them.

As he watched the mental power enhancers disappear into the delivery station’s transport system, he recalled Teacher Xiaobai’s words: Only by being your own knight can you keep walking down this difficult path.

From now on, he would be his own knight.

Chu Jiangting smiled slightly, turned around, and walked toward his dorm in the cool breeze of the night.

After settling the panda cub, Bai Nuosi checked on the little black snake. It was still sleeping soundly, with no signs of anything unusual, but Bai Nuosi felt it had gone to sleep too early and too deeply today, so he decided to take it to the doctor tomorrow just to be safe.

He quietly closed the nursery door and returned to his own room. First, he took a shower, and after that, he started cooking some instant noodles, adding a few homemade fish and meatballs, along with tomatoes and vegetables. Setting the timer for the gas stove, he filled his watering can and headed to the windowsill to water his two little rose plants.

The roses were growing beautifully, with a few new leaves sprouting, and they looked full of life. Bai Nuosi was delighted. 

“Drip, drip, the rain is falling. 

Drink up, little roses. 

Grow more branches tomorrow 

and bloom the day after.”

The little roses, now well-watered, had tender leaves and firm, upright stems, looking like they would bloom soon.

After watering the roses, Bai Nuosi went to the small garden in the yard to check on the white rabbit.

Earlier, he had made a simple shelter for the rabbit with branches and plastic. Though he could’ve made something better, he didn’t have the time. He had ordered a proper one from StarNet, but it wouldn’t arrive until tomorrow.

From the kitchen, he took some fresh vegetable leaves and fruit, chopped them into small pieces, placed them in a glass bowl, and put them in the rabbit’s nest.

He also changed the rabbit’s water.

The little rabbit was already asleep, but as soon as Bai Nuosi arrived, it woke up again. For some reason, this little fluff ball never seemed to be afraid of people. When it saw Bai Nuosi, it didn’t hide or run away. Instead, it just sat there. When Bai Nuosi put down the food, the rabbit ran over and eagerly began munching on the fruit.

Bai Nuosi affectionately reached out and patted the rabbit’s back gently. He whispered, “You don’t have a name yet. Qiuqiu said you’re Naby, so should we call you Naby from now on? If you don’t like it, just shake your head.”

The little rabbit paid no attention to Bai Nuosi and continued munching away, clearly very hungry today.

Bai Nuosi withdrew his hand and nodded to himself, “Since you’re not objecting, we’ll call you Naby from now on, okay?”

Naby: Chomp, chomp, chomp.

Ah, sweet fruit really is delicious, so juicy and full of sweetness. Naby’s mouth was soon smeared with red fruit juice.

Watching small animals eat is truly stress-relieving. Bai Nuosi, who rarely had time to himself after the two cubs went to sleep, found this moment of peace.

He squatted in the garden, propping his chin up with his hand, and watched the little white rabbit eat. He ended up watching for over ten minutes.

Suddenly inspired, Bai Nuosi opened his smart device and recorded a video of the rabbit munching on the fruit, posting it to his StarNet livestream account: [Caught by the snake, named by Qiuqiu, and almost returned by the little black panther: here’s Little Naby’s first mukbang! Heart emoji JPG.]

Beneath the title was a twenty-second video of the little white rabbit eating a sweet fruit.

There wasn’t anything particularly special about the video. It simply showed a fluffy white rabbit crunching away at a small red fruit. With every bite, red juice spilled from its mouth, smearing the rabbit’s face.

The little rabbit seemed to really love the fruit, continuously munching on it with an oddly mesmerizing sound. It was the kind of video you couldn’t stop watching!

The viewers, who had been patiently waiting in the livestream, suddenly found themselves entranced by this rabbit’s eating video. Instantly, they filled the chat with comments:

[Even though I was hoping for a livestream of the spirit cubs, I can’t seem to stop watching this little rabbit! Why is this so addicting? Crying soybean emoji.]

[Is this Little Naby? Wait, did Qiuqiu the panda cub really name it? No offense, but… did the silly Qiuqiu really come up with such a cute name? Dog head emoji.]

[Oh no, this video is weirdly addictive. I’ve already watched it at least five times! Little Naby is so adorable. Auntie’s going to buy you more sweet fruits! Gift x5.]

[Whether it’s the cubs or Little Naby, please, Teacher Xiao Bai, update more videos! Every day I wait for the livestream, and it’s torture! Please give us more content, I’m begging you!]

Bai Nuosi hadn’t intended to update a video. It was just a spur-of-the-moment idea because he found Little Naby so cute while eating the sweet fruit that he wanted to capture the moment as a keepsake.

He never expected that his fans would enjoy it so much or even start demanding more updates.

After posting the video, he shut down his device and made sure the little rabbit’s nest was warm and dry. Only then did he close the small side door to the nest, leaving the rabbit to rest on its own.

As he slowly stood up, he looked around and suddenly spotted Huo Ranchuan!

Bai Nuosi was startled. When did Huo Ranchuan arrive? He saw the head of the nursery walking toward him, looking a bit uneasy and hesitant, as if he had something to say but didn’t know how to start.

Bai Nuosi quickly walked over, feeling a bit excited. He hadn’t seen Huo Ranchuan in a while.

“Director Huo!”

Bai Nuosi smiled. “Are you here so late to check on the panda cub?”

Director Huo had seemed quite concerned when the panda cub had an allergic reaction recently.

Then again, Huo Ranchuan had always been a responsible director. When the little black panther had fallen ill and been hospitalized, Director Huo had shown similar concern.

This sense of responsibility was one of the things that made Bai Nuosi like him.

Huo Ranchuan hesitated for a moment, glanced at the rabbit’s nest in the corner of the garden, and asked, though he already knew the answer, “Is that your new pet?”

Bai Nuosi nodded, a bit embarrassed. “Yes, it’s a little white rabbit.”

He suddenly remembered that this was a nursery, and since he only worked and lived in the staff dormitory, keeping a pet required permission.

Not wanting the director to question it, he quickly explained, “The little rabbit was caught by the snake baby. I asked Supervisor Mons, and he said it was fine to keep it, so I brought it back.”

Huo Ranchuan nodded, and seeing how cautious Bai Nuosi was, he softened a bit. “If you like it, keep it. If you ever need anything, just let me know. It’s not a problem.”

Bai Nuosi felt a little shy. He really appreciated how great the nursery was, and both the director and supervisor were so kind. At most nursery, teachers weren’t allowed to keep pets.

Usually, it was out of concern that pets might affect the health of the babies.

But perhaps because this nursery was full of beastmen, the rules weren’t as strict here.

Bai Nuosi led Huo Ranchuan back to the dormitory, lowering his voice as he said, “Director, the panda cub is doing well today. It fell asleep right after drinking its milk. Do you want to check on it?”

As they entered the small living room, Huo Ranchuan was immediately hit by the strong aroma of instant noodles.

His brow furrowed slightly. He recalled that the last time he visited this late, Teacher Bai had also been eating instant noodles.

He takes such good care of the cubs, working so hard every day—why is he living on instant noodles?

This really isn’t healthy at all.

Although Mons sends food and supplies regularly, Teacher Xiaobai must be too exhausted to cook. But what could he say? As the director, it wasn’t his place to interfere with Bai Nuosi’s personal life as long as he was doing his job well.

Huo Ranchuan was torn as he stared at the instant noodles in the kitchen, unsure of how to address the situation.

Meanwhile, Bai Nuosi had already opened the nursery door, and Huo Ranchuan could see a soft, warm light spilling out, along with the gentle sound of music. His heightened senses confirmed that the two cubs were fast asleep.

Bai Nuosi was dressed in pale blue short-sleeved pajamas, his white arms and straight legs exposed. In the dim light, his half-damp hair hung softly over his forehead, and his bright, starry eyes twinkled as he spoke quietly, “Both cubs are asleep, but something seems off with the snake baby.”

Frowning slightly with worry, Bai Nuosi continued, “The snake baby hasn’t been in high spirits today. It seemed unusually tired and fell asleep over an hour earlier than usual. I didn’t even have to coax it. I suspect it might not be feeling well, but since it’s sleeping so deeply and peacefully, and it ate and drank normally before bed, there weren’t any other abnormal signs. I figured I’d wait until tomorrow morning to take it to the doctor.”

Although that’s what Bai Nuosi said, deep down, he was still anxious.

After all, these beast cubs weren’t like human babies, and he was worried he might overlook something important, which could delay their treatment.

Now that Huo Ranchuan had arrived, Bai Nuosi felt a wave of relief wash over him—finally, someone he could consult with! After all, the snake baby was raised by Huo Ranchuan himself, and no one understood its condition better than him.

Seeing the worry on Bai Nuosi’s face, Huo Ranchuan’s tone softened as he said quietly, “You don’t need to worry; this is normal.”

Huo Ranchuan paused for a moment, looking into Bai Nuosi’s bright black eyes, his voice unusually gentle: “The snake baby is shedding its skin. I came over today to take it back home.”

Bai Nuosi: “…”

Bai Nuosi’s mouth opened slightly in shock and confusion. “S-shedding its skin?”

This was beyond anything he had imagined.

Though he knew snakes shed their skin, he had never connected that concept to a beastman baby!
